This is complicated to duplicate... setup:
PBX A has A2B installed and has all out/in voip trunks.
PBX B is in office B and connects to PBX A via iax2
PBX C is in office C and connects to PBX A via iax2
A2B has a 1 DID destination for each office that rings a ring group
A2B has also 1 failover destination for office B and another for office C that goes to a cell phone, where VOIP call is set to "NO" and priority is set to "2"
BAD Strange behavior:
user in Office B places a call to the DID in Office C.
Office C rings and answer the call.
Both offices finishes and hangup.
Immediately both cell phones will ring and when they both answer they are connected together. The first cell to answer will hear a line ringing. If only one party hangs up and the other stay on the line. the party that stay on the line will hear it ringing and the cell of the party that hung-up will ring. the call is completed.
This happens every time.
Failover works fine in the event that either PBX goes off line.
Running A2b 1.9.3 PIAF 1.4 on all PBXs.
